stoffel wrote:The gold one obviously is printed in gold ink and comes on a smaller cardboard type of paper

there is a smaller silver bone guitar that's the same size as the velvet bone guitar.......they are much smaller than the older bone and silver bone guitar handbills but not as small as the gold paper version.

The last two auctions on ebay listed under the bone handbill were actually the Mini-silver handbills I described above.
